What does a host do?

A Host in a restaurant is responsible for greeting guests as they arrive, managing reservations, and seating customers in a timely and organized manner. They are often the first point of contact for guests and play a key role in creating a positive first impression. Hosts also help manage the waitlist, answer phones, and sometimes assist with other front-of-house tasks. Their main goal is to ensure guests have a smooth and pleasant dining experience from the moment they enter the restaurant.

How does a host typically collaborate with other restaurant staff during a busy shift?

As a Host, you play a central role in ensuring smooth operations by working closely with servers, bussers, and kitchen staff. You coordinate seating plans and communicate wait times to guests, while also relaying important information to servers, such as large parties or special requests. During peak hours, teamwork and clear communication are essential to manage guest flow, minimize wait times, and provide a positive dining experience. This collaborative environment helps you build strong relationships with your team and develop essential interpersonal skills.

What is the difference between Host vs Waitstaff?

AspectHostWaitstaff
Primary RoleGreet guests, manage reservations, seat customersTake orders, serve food and drinks, assist guests at tables
Required SkillsCustomer service, organization, communicationCustomer service, multitasking, menu knowledge
Work EnvironmentFront entrance, reception areaDining area, service stations
Common CertificationsNone typically requiredFood handler permits, alcohol service certification

While both hosts and waitstaff work in restaurant settings and focus on customer service, hosts primarily manage guest seating and reservations, whereas waitstaff take orders and serve food. Both roles require strong communication skills, but waitstaff often need specific food service certifications. Understanding these differences helps clarify job expectations in the hospitality industry.

What do hosts get paid?

Hosts typically earn an hourly wage that ranges from minimum wage to around $15-$20 per hour, depending on the industry, location, and experience. Some hosts also receive tips, which can significantly increase their total earnings, especially in the hospitality and restaurant sectors. Pay rates may vary based on the employer and whether the position is part-time or full-time.
